Abstract

A thermo-preserving container includes a body and a cone-shaped cap. The body consists of an annular inner wall and an annular outer wall, with an annular empty space defined between the inner and the outer wall for filling coolant therein through an intake bored in a bottom of the body. The intake is inserted with a stopper to keep the coolant in the annular empty space. The body has an inner empty space surrounded by the annular inner wall. The cone-shaped cap is provided with an annular connect member in a bottom end to threadably combined with the connect member of the body to combine the cap with the body. Then a drink or a wine in a bottle can be kept in the thermo-preserving container in a cooled condition, preserving the drink or wine to taste comparatively cool and fresh.

Description

    BACKGROUND OF THE INVENTION
  • 1. Field of the Invention
  • This invention relates to a thermo-preserving container, particularly to one preserving liquor, drinks, or food in a low temperature, convenient to carry so that the content kept therein may taste comparatively cool and fresh.
  • 2. Description of the Prior Art
  • Common drinks, liquors or refreshments are to be kept in a refrigerator to be cooled for some degrees or to be added with ice cubes, if it is wanted to taste cool and fresh for drinking with pleasant perception and feeling. However, if it is added with ice cubes for cooling a drink or refreshment, it may taste rather thin, losing the original flavor, and moreover, after the drink is taken out of the refrigerator, it will soon become warmer gradually under the room temperature, not tasting cool and fresh. Or a drink may be carried in a large thermo-preserving box filled with ice for keeping the drink cool, but the thermo-preserving box may be a little too large to carry along, not convenient to use.
  • SUMMARY OF THE INVENTION
  • This invention has been devised to offer a thermo-preserving container that can keep a drink, refreshment or food in a low temperature to taste cool and fresh, in addition to being handy to carry along.
  • The feature of the invention is a body consisting of an annular inner wall and an annular outer wall, with a cool medium filled in an annular empty space between the inner and the outer wall. An intake is provided in the bottom of the body for coolant to be filled in the annular empty space and closed up with a stopper after the coolant is filled therein, and an annular connect member is formed in an inner upper end of the body. The body has an inner empty interior and a cone-shaped cap is closed on the body, having an annular connect member to threadably connect with the annular connect member of the body.

  • D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T
  • A first embodiment of a thermo-preserving container in the present invention, as shown in FIGS. 1 and 2, includes a body 1 and a cone-shaped cap 2 threadably closed on the body 1.
  • The body 1 consists of an annular inner wall 10 and an annular outer wall and an annular empty space (S) defined between the inner and the outer wall 10 and 11. Then a coolant is filled in the annular empty space (S), composed of a proper amount of a sterilizer (LXE) and anti-fungi agent, XB-2 and NIMBRIME mixed with water. Further the body is provided with an intake 13 in the bottom, and a stopper 14 inserted in the intake 13 after the coolant is filled in the annular empty space (S). Further the body 1 is provided with an inner empty space 17 surrounded by the annular inner wall 10, an annular connect member 15 with female threads formed in an upper end, an annular decorative member 16 formed in the outer portion of the upper end and made of a different material or differently colored from the body.
  • The cone-shaped cap 2 is provided with an annular connect member 20 with male threads formed in a bottom end, and the connect member 20 has an annular connect edge 200 in an upper end, with the connect member 20 located just on the decorative member 16 and with the male threads engaged with the female threads of the body 1. Further, the cone-shaped cap is provided with a grip hole 21 formed in an upper end, enabling the body 1 together with the cap 2 to be carried with a hand.
  • In using, as shown FIGS. 1, 2 and 3, coolant 12 is poured in the empty space (S) of the body 1 through the intake 13, with the stopper 14 inserted in the intake 13. Next, a wine bottle (A) with wine is placed in the inner empty space 17, and then the cone-shaped cap 2 is closed on the body 1, by engaging the annular connect member 20 of the cap 2 with the annular connect member 15 of the body 1, with the annular connect edge 200 resting just on the upper end of the decorative member 16. Then the wine bottle (A) is visible through the annular inner wall 10 and the annular outer wall 11, giving a beautifying appearance, and the body 1 together with the cap 2 can be carried with a hand by inserting a finger in the grip hole 21 of the cap 2. Then the wine in the wine bottle (A) may be kept cool and conveniently carried along.
  • Next, a second embodiment of a thermo-preserving container in the invention is shown in FIGS. 4 and 5, which includes a body 1 and a cap 2.
  • The body 1 is shaped cylindrical, having a rather large diameter, also consisting of an annular inner wall 10 and an annular outer wall 11, with an annular empty space (S) defined between the inner and the outer wall 10 and 11 for a coolant to be filled therein. Further the body 1 is provided with an intake 13 in its bottom and a stopper 14 inserted in the intake 13 after the coolant is filled in the annular empty space (S), and a connect member 15 with female threads formed in an upper end, an annular decorative member 16 formed in the outer portion of the upper end, and an inner empty space 17 surrounded by the annular inner wall 10.
  • The flat cap 2 is threadably combined on the body 1, provided with an annular connect member 20 with male threads and an annular connect edge 200. Then the male threads of the connect member 20 engage with the female threads of the connect member 15 of the body 1, with the connect member 20 just located on the decorative member 16. Further the cap 2 is provided with a grip hole 21 formed on the center of an upper surface, enabling the body 1 together with the cap 2 to be carried with a hand. Moreover, the cap 2 is provided with an inner empty space 22.
  • In using the second embodiment of the thermo-preserving container, fresh fruit or vegetable (B) can be placed in the inner empty space 17, and the body 1 closed with the cap 2 by engagement of the male threads and the female threads of the connect members 15 and 20 is possible to be carried in a hand, with the food preserved cool and fresh and eatable with cool feeling and good hygiene.
